Is 650 029 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 650 029 is about 806.244.

Thus, the square root of 650 029 is not an integer, and therefore 650 029 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 650 029?

The square of a number (here 650 029) is the result of the product of this number (650 029) by itself (i.e., 650 029 × 650 029); the square of 650 029 is sometimes called "raising 650 029 to the power 2", or "650 029 squared".

The square of 650 029 is 422 537 700 841 because 650 029 × 650 029 = 650 0292 = 422 537 700 841.

As a consequence, 650 029 is the square root of 422 537 700 841.
